Description
"Presented in accordance with current numismatic standards of description, analysis, and publication, Alan Craig's account of the coins goes far beyond ordinary standards to bring alive the history of the coins' production, transport, and loss at sea. The perfect guide to this treasure-house, Craig's book conveys the importance and fascination of the largest known collection of Spanish colonial shipwreck coins in the world.". "For collectors, scholars, and everyone else who has ever been fascinated by Spanish treasure fleets, this book offers countless hours of enjoyment and information."--BOOK JACKET.
